We are looking for a Head Pizza Chef who lives and breathes dough, fire, flavour and consistency. This is not a corporate kitchen. This is a quality-driven Italian restaurant with a strong reputation, loyal customers, and a genuine love for great pizza. The pizza section is the heart of the business and this role owns it.
The Role
- Full responsibility for the pizza section
- Dough prep, fermentation, shaping...
